WEB开发网
开发学院软件开发VC 模拟器和远程调试工具(二) 阅读

模拟器和远程调试工具(二)

 2007-03-17 21:26:55 来源:WEB开发网   
核心提示: 图4 进程浏览程序截图7、远程注册表编辑程序(Remote Registry Editor)此程序和其它Windows 操作系统下的注册表编辑器非常相似,但它能够显示、编译开发平台下的注册表和实际平台下的注册表,模拟器和远程调试工具(二)(4),如图5所示,具体操作我就不多说了,串口的速度

图4 进程浏览程序截图

7、远程注册表编辑程序(Remote Registry Editor)

此程序和其它Windows 操作系统下的注册表编辑器非常相似。但它能够显示、编译开发平台下的注册表和实际平台下的注册表。如图5所示。具体操作我就不多说了。CE下注册表的限制我也曾说过了。

图5 注册表编辑器截图

8、远程消息监视程序(Remote Spy)

这个程序和VC下附带的工具spy非常相似。能够列出所有实际平台下的窗口和窗口消息。我想这个程序也不用我多说了吧。熟悉VC下的工具,就能操作这个工具。界面如图6所示。

图6 消息监视界面截图

9、远程系统信息(Remote System Information)

这个工具能够查看实际平台的系统信息,包括硬件和软件的信息。

图7 系统信息截图

10、远程屏幕截图程序(Remote Zoom-in)

此工具能够截取实际平台屏幕图像。这个工具最适合写说明书了。假如一个产品要推向市场,那说明书或演示程序必须准备好。用这个程序截图放到说明书或演示程序中。截图单击“File”-“New Bitmap”。这个程序的界面我就不给出了。

总结

10个远程工具为我们开发内核和应用程序提供了很大的帮助。显然有些工具很少用,有些工具常用。对于注册表编辑器,在一些嵌入式网站有源码和程序可下载。把注册表编辑器带到内核中运行会更有效,更节省时间。这10个工具中,最帅的就是内核跟踪程序了,通过内核跟踪程序,整个内核启动过程清晰可见。还可以用它监视你的应用程序。有一点还要说明:这10个远程调试工具我是在模拟器上试验的。如果要调试实际平台,必须先通过串口、网卡把开发平台和实际平台连接起来。在“Target”-“Configure Remote Connection”中设置。实际设备最好有网卡,串口的速度太慢了。这方面请参考帮助文件,帮助文件中说的非常详细了。

上一页  1 2 3 4 

Tags:模拟器 远程 调试

编辑录入:爽爽 [复制链接] [打 印]
赞助商链接